// COMPONENT_LIB_PIN — welcome aboard! This pins the Marigold shared
// component library for the whole Thistledown frontend. We don't float
// minor versions because Marigold's "minor" bumps have broken theming
// twice. Bump it deliberately: update here, run the visual diff suite,
// and get a sign-off from the design-systems channel. The exact build
// that last passed the full visual regression pass is noted below.

pipeline stamp: htk9_6ce9d33c5

Quick note on retry semantics for the Pebbleworth webhook dispatcher: we retry failed deliveries with exponential backoff (1s, 4s, 16s, max 5 attempts), then park the event in the dead-letter table. Don't "fix" the jitter — it's intentional, keeps us from hammering slow consumers. Parked events get replayed by the sweeper job every 10 minutes. The sweeper reads its queue from the primary store, reachable via the following connection string.

replica DSN, tawef-hahap: mysql://eliix_svc:FiIC0jz@db-394a.lumiclabs.internal:5432/holius

## Deployment

Largediff runs as a stateless container behind the Venholt gateway. It streams file chunks rather than loading whole files into memory, so worker memory limits can stay modest even for multi-gigabyte inputs. All diff artifacts are written to a temp volume that is wiped on pod restart; nothing persists between sessions. TLS terminates at the gateway, and the service only accepts traffic from the internal mesh. The reviewer-relevant settings are listed below.

deployment values, kajep-kageg:
[praix]
host = praix.paliqcorp.corp
user = praix_svc
database = praix_prod

Release channel: fan-out backpressure fix for Quillbird notifications is ready for review. The dispatcher now sheds load by deferring low-priority topics when the outbound queue exceeds 80% capacity, instead of blocking producers. Verified under synthetic burst of 50k events/min with no producer stalls. Please review the shedding thresholds before Friday. Candidate build is referenced below.

pipeline stamp: htk9_ce63042d9